Watching for the first time today, and I used the Pitchproof plugin (also for the first time) yesterday. It's not the best but I don't think it's the worst and it's free which is great for my bank balance! What I will say is I noticed artifacts early on and I managed to clean it up by playing around with the settings in the bottom of the GUI. Rather bizarrely, I think I noticed less artifacts when I switched off "Transient Fix". No idea why. Also I noticed that once your guitar gets a certain amount out of tune, Pitchproof really struggles. But I'm happy with it for a free plugin, and I see no reason right this second to pay for anything better!
